Knowing what you’re spending and where your money is going will: eliminate the guessing, make your money go farther, reduce the guilt and stress associated with spending, show you where you are overspending, and show you the possibility for saving.
Reasons why you don’t have a budget:
You’re afraid of what you’ll find
You feel too constrained
You never had one that worked
Reasons your past budgets didn’t work:
You left things out
You didn’t plan for the unexpected
It was too complicated
You didn’t stick to it
Following a plan will help you change your budgeting woes into a better financial future. There will be a time investment at first, but will get easier and less time consuming.
